It's all Fighting Irish in Pittsburgh. It has been all Notre Dame in the first half, with the Fighting Irish taking a 21-3 lead into halftime. Notre Dame has gained 240 yards to Pitt's 81, through two quarters, holding freshman quarterback Mason Heintschel to 9 of 21 passing for 74 yards with an interception.

Heading into the game against Syracuse, most Notre Dame fans expected this Fighting Irish team to come out with a dominant victory. I’m not sure many expected a 70 to 7 win, especially when the final score doesn’t even adequately tell the full story for how lopsided the contest truly was.
